Analysis

The most recent figure for artichokes — gross production value in Northern America is 21,130 1000 Int$, measured in 2024.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 13.2% on the previous year and down 29.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, artichokes — gross production value in Northern America peaked at 42,069 1000 Int$ in 1985 and was at its lowest, 13,835 1000 Int$, in 1962.

Northern America ranks 12th of 21 groups on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 64 years of available data.

The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
